SUBMISSION OF RETURN AFTER SURRENDER OF REGISTERATION

S.C. WADHWA
A Manufacturing company named XYZ Ltd. amalgamated
with another company named ABC Pvt. Ltd.. As a result, name of
XYZ Ltd. become XYZ (A Division of ABC Pvt Ltd.).

If XYZ ltd. surrenders its excise and service tax registeration on 25/08/14, whether it will be eligible to submit its return on due date i.e. 10/09/14 and 25/10/14 respectively or return cannot be submitted after surrender of registeration.

Please advise whether return can be submitted or not after surrender of registeration.
